Heres some up to date info's about the polos replacement....

Bought pretty much standard and done pretty much all the work so far by myself!

Engine

-Fujitsubo 4-2-1 manifold

-Spoon cat back exhaust with N1 silencer

-Spoon engine mounts with lower mounts silicon filled for extra stiffness

-A/C removed

-Spoon direct flow intake pipe

-Trust panel filter

-Spoon oil cap

-Spoon resevoir socks

-Spoon radiator stay bracket

-RR results 192bhp @ 8800rpm

Brakes

-Spoon twinblock 4 pot calipers

-Rear calipers refurbed

-Goodridge braided hoses with stainless fixings

-Endless CCX pads all round

-AP dixcel PD discs

-Motul RBF600 fluid

Wheels

-Standard enkei wheels powdercoated

-Hankook RS2 tyres 205/50/15

Suspension

-Tein SS coilovers with pillow top mounts

-Car fully rebushed with Mugen RTA bushes, hardrace bushes throughout, poly ARB bushes front and rear

-New oem honda drop links/track rod ends/ball joints

-Eibach SPC front camber/castor adjustable upper arms

-Eibach SPC rear camber adjustable upper arms

-All suspension arms stripped and repainted

-Geometry set at full extra castor, -2.5 camber front, -1.5 camber rear, 1.5mm toe out per side front, 3mm toe out per side rear

-Spoon front upper strut brace

Inside

-DC2 integra seat rails modified to fit

-Momo montecarlo 350mm wheel

-Splash SRS wheel hub

-LTB 1" wheel spacer

Outside

-Standard

hows the ride at the bottom of the coilovers (or at least looks bottom lol)

it's good! although the spring rates are a bit soft for my liking so selling the coilovers after winter and changing to a set of either Spoon or Buddyclub with more suitable spring rates, also with the Spoon/Buddyclub i will be able to run the same height without the coilovers wound right down :lol:
